CandleScience Overview
CandleScience is a United States-based supplier specializing in candle making and soap making supplies, including fragrance oils, waxes, wicks, jars, and related products. Established over two decades ago, it operates primarily through online retail supported by warehouses located in North Carolina and Reno, Nevada. The company serves as a significant resource hub for both hobbyists and small candle businesses.
The business model combines direct-to-consumer sales and wholesale distribution with a focus on delivering educational resources, such as tutorials and product testing data, to support its customers' knowledge and production quality. CandleScience maintains an in-house lab for product testing and ensures that many of its fragrance oils meet safety standards, including phthalate-free and Proposition 65 compliance. Its operations are mainly concentrated in the United States with limited international shipping options.

CandleScience Pros & Cons
CandleScience offers a reliable selection of high-quality fragrance oils and a wide range of products suitable for both beginners and professional candle makers. Their fast processing and shipping from multiple US warehouses, combined with extensive educational resources and in-house product testing, provide a thorough support system for customers focused on product safety and compliance.
However, potential buyers should consider the higher shipping costs, which in some cases may exceed the product cost, and reported inconsistencies in fragrance potency between batches. Customer service may also present challenges due to response delays and the absence of phone support, along with a limited return policy that often requires customers to cover return shipping expenses.

CandleScience Return Policy
The return policy does not specify a set number of days for returns. Customers are typically responsible for paying return shipping fees when they choose to send back products. Returns are accepted for some items but must comply with strict policy conditions set by the company.
There is limited warranty coverage and refunds for defective batches, with policies varying depending on the product. Customers should be aware that return eligibility and refund terms differ by item. The policy emphasizes adherence to specific rules to qualify for returns and refunds.
CandleScience Shipping Policy
Shipping is primarily available within the United States with limited international options. Orders are fulfilled from two US-based warehouses located in North Carolina and Nevada to facilitate faster processing and delivery. This setup helps in managing geographic distribution efficiently.
Same-day processing is common, though delivery times can vary depending on location. Tracking is available for shipped orders. Shipping costs are generally high, particularly for smaller orders, and free shipping thresholds are subject to change and may not apply to all purchases.
